Renfe

About
Renfe is Spain’s national train company operating freight and passenger on Spain’s extensive railway network as well as international routes to neighboring France and Portugal. Renfe has a wide range of ticket types to fit your budget like the Basic, Elige and Premium tickets. Renfe also offers discount cards like the Renfe Gold Card and +Renfe Youth Card 50 for qualified travelers. The Renfe AVE trains run at high speed and serve long-distance routes, Alvia trains combine high-speed and normal speed trains serving domestic routes, Altaria serves domestic routes into southern Spain, Euromed offers domestic routes along the Mediterranean coast, Avant trains serve regional commuter routes and Trenhotel offers night train routes.

Cercanías

About
Cercanías is the commuter rail service operated by Renfe, Spain's national railway company, connecting metropolitan areas across the country. Established in 1989, it aims to provide frequent and high-capacity transportation for daily commuters and travelers. Cercanías operates in 12 urban areas, including Madrid, Barcelona (where it's known as Rodalies), Valencia (Rodalia), and Bilbao (Aldiriak). The service integrates with other public transport systems like metro networks, simplifying urban and suburban travel. Ticket options include single, return, and 10-journey "Bonotren" tickets, with prices varying by zone. A notable feature is the "Combinado Cercanías," offering free transfers on Cercanías trains when purchasing long-distance or high-speed AVE tickets. Cercanías trains typically run from early morning until around midnight.

Where do the trains from Valencia to Gandía depart from and arrive at?

Valencia-Joaquín Sorolla train station: This is a modern station recently built to house the departures and arrivals of high-speed trains. Five city bus lines get here: 9, 10, 27, 89 and 90. It also has an internal bus that connects it with the Estación del Norte, as well as several intercity buses, such as those from Dénia and Jávea. The nearest metro station is Jesus. It has parking for private vehicles. In the interior there are numerous commercial and catering premises, as well as bathrooms, lockers and other services.

Gandía train station: is an underground station located in Parc de l'Estaciò. It provides a permanent train service, as it is the head of line C1 of Cercanías Valencia, useful for reaching other localities such as Xeraco, Sueca or Catarroja, among others. All local bus lines, managed by La Marina Gandiense, stop on the surface: 1, 2, 3, 4, 5 and 6. In addition, many other intercity buses leave from here, in the direction of Benidorm, Alicante and other destinations. Your lobby has a waiting area and information booths. In the vicinity there is parking for cars, cafes, restaurants, commercial premises and a tourist office.
